Maybe you don't plan on buying anything new soon, but everyone who has insurance on their gear needs to be aware of the new prices so they can update their policy to get the current replacement value. For some people, this is a difference of thousands of dollars per item. The Canon 400 2.8 L was selling for around 4999 at some places a few years ago and now its about 7100. Big difference for just 2-3 years.

When it comes to photo gear, the used market is usually heavily affected by the new market -- at least when it comes to current technology at any rate. Back when I was a dealer, I would price my used gear that was current technology based on current new prices, not on what it sold for originally. And so would all the other dealers I knew. And all the dealers in Shutterbug, etc.

So yes, I would expect the rise in prices to have a direct impact on used recent- or current-model EOS and EF gear.
